Thank you, Anthony. Hello, and welcome everyone. I'm happy to be here with all of you today to share our fourth quarter and full fiscal year results. We once again delivered strong performance driven by broad adoption of our offerings and the continued growth of Elastic cloud. In Q4 revenue grew 44% year-over-year, and we once again saw robust customer acquisitions and expansion metrics. We ended the quarter with more than 15,000 subscription customers, including over 730 with annual contract value of more than $100,000. Looking at the full fiscal year, revenue grew 42%. First, I'm happy to share that the frozen data tier powered by searchable snapshots is now generally available. Data is growing exponentially, and our customers must be able to do more than just store it. They need data to be easily accessible and always on and fully searchable at a moment's notice regardless of temperature. With searchable snapshots in the new frozen tier, customers can now search petabytes of data in just minutes anytime they want. They will not be forced to delete data to reduce costs with the power to easily balance the speed of results with the cost of storage. In fact, one of the world's largest telecommunications companies will leverage searchable snapshots and the frozen data to better manage their high volume logging data and storage requirements. The customer started with our free basic gear and needed a reliable and cost effective ways to keep up with growing data volumes and during major launch events. In addition, new business requirements demanded they started loving there after 60 days instead of seven, they upgraded to an enterprise subscription to take advantage of the tremendous value provided by searchable snapshots. Now, the customer can more effectively manage the growing data volumes in Elastic while meeting their data retention requirements. Our differentiated implementation of schema on read, what we call run-time field is also now generally available. Run time fields provide an easy and flexible way to onboard data and make it searchable. Users can immediately interact with and enrich their data without defined fields. In one click, they can switch to the blazing speed of schema on write benefiting from the power of choice and speed in a single integrated search platform. Now, on to our observability solution, enterprises continue to expand their digital footprints and move to the cloud at an ever increasing pace. They need to observe their applications and cloud infrastructure to keep these complex digital ecosystems available and performing is becoming more and more critical. Elastic observability helps customers by unifying the various types of observability data like logs, metrics, and APM space into a single search platform. It allows customers to easily monitor and respond to any event happening anywhere in any environment. In Q4, we closed the business with a major national home improvement retailer who was looking to gain better visibility and performance insights into the more than 40 mobile and in-store applications. These applications are used to manage their retail operations across over 2000 locations. The company chose the last date over the current provider because we delivered significantly faster speeds and better integrations of logs and APM data. This enables them to better monitor and respond to events happening in their order management and supply chain management applications, point of sale systems and other digital environments. We're seeing recognition from industry analysts in the APM space as well. Elastic was recognized for the first time in Gartner's evaluation of APM vendors and was named a visionary in the 2021 Gartner's Magic Quadrant for application performance monitoring. And we continue to simplify the ability to onboard any data into Elastic observability. We announced native support for OpenTelemetry, providing even more flexibility for customers to own board data. In addition to using our unified agent to collect and send data to the Elastic stack, organizations can now directly send data collected by OpenTelemetry agents to the same Elastic deployment. I'm also excited to share that we announced an extended integration with Microsoft that featured enhanced support for Azure monitoring use cases, which was just demos during the Microsoft Build Conference last week. Customers can now easily onboard logs and mix for their Azure services directly in Azure to our observability solution in just a few clicks. Moving to our security solution, companies are continuing to generate more and more data everywhere. And this data plays a critical role in their ability to protect themselves from attack. Elastic security helps protect companies by making all of this data searchable and actionable from the endpoint to the data center to the cloud. It unifies security capabilities such as SIEM, endpoint security and threat hunting in a single search platform, equipping analysts to seamlessly prevent, detect and respond to threats. This quarter, we closed the deal with a major real estate developer in Japan with more than 20,000 employees. They were looking to protect their large remote workforce using a scalable and easy to maintain solution that offered a simple pricing structure. Using Elastic security on Elastic cloud, the customer established a security operation center in just a few months and quickly launched our SIEM to drive their security operations. We also expand in business this quarter with a major public research university in the US. Their security teams scope the expanded to include both the campus and the University Hospital. The customers have been using our sync capabilities under a gold subscription and upgraded to a platinum subscription to take advantage of our machine learning and our learning capabilities. Now, even though the customer's scope has expanded, and they are ingesting far more data than they were before, they are still able to stay on top of tracks across their entire environment. It's great to see real world examples of how our solutions are able to flexibly grow with customers, giving them the added functionality they need when they need it. We accelerated the hunting and investigation with the general availability of analysts proven correlation powered by EQL. This critical correlation capability provides a new type of search experience for practitioners to quickly identify threat. Additionally, we learn support for central management and deployment of [indiscernible], a large and rapidly growing open source project. This integration allows customers to reach out to hosts and endpoints and search them, effectively folding them into our search platform. It is useful to threat hunters security analysts in ID operation is everywhere. Now, if our report comes along from malicious Chrome extension, finding who has it installed across the organization, it just a simple search query away. We continue to invest in our cloud offering, expanding strategic partnership with cloud providers and supporting customers with a simple worry free and easy to use Cloud experience. In Q4, we closed the deal with one of the largest U.S. retailers of automatic parts and accessories. We are supporting them in their decision to move all of their Elastic usage to Elastic cloud. Like many of our customers, the company has grown with us over time, starting with logging and APM and expanding to security and enterprise search as different groups across the business so the value and leveraging our platform. As adoption of Elastic within the company has grown, they have recognized the value of our Elastic cloud worry-free managed service. We have also expanded our strategic partnership and first party integration with Microsoft. Customers can now deploy an Elastic cloud as if it was a native Azure service. They can also ship monitoring data to it as if it was a native Azure service.
